Japandi Interior Design
Japandi seamlessly blends Japanese minimalism with Scandinavian functionality, creating spaces that are both serene and inviting. This design philosophy emphasizes natural materials, clean lines, and a neutral color palette that brings warmth and tranquility to any room.

Frequently Asked Questions
Japandi is a fusion of Japanese and Scandinavian design principles, combining minimalism, natural materials, and functional beauty.
Japandi uses a neutral palette including warm whites, soft beiges, muted greens, and natural wood tones.
Focus on decluttering, choosing quality over quantity, incorporating natural materials like wood and stone, and maintaining a neutral color scheme.
